RR School of Architecture Fees structure

1. Tuition Fees

The tuition fee supports the academic curriculum, including theoretical classes, studio sessions, workshops, and design projects.

Fee Breakdown:

  • Core academic sessions: Lectures, tutorials, and practical classes.

  • Use of advanced architecture software & resources.

  • Access to studios and labs for project-based learning.

Approximate Annual Tuition Fee: ₹1,50,000 – ₹2,00,000 (subject to revision).

2. Admission Fees

A one-time non-refundable fee for administrative activities such as registration, enrollment, and student record management.

Services Covered:

  • Issuance of ID cards and welcome kits.

  • Orientation programs for new students.

Approximate Fee: ₹10,000 – ₹15,000.

3. Exam Fees

RR School of Architecture costs of conducting internal assessments, semester-end theory, and practical exams and issuing mark sheets.

What’s Included:

  • Exam scheduling and invigilation.

  • Evaluation by faculty and external examiners.

  • Certificate issuance post-semester results.

Approximate Fee Per Semester: ₹3,000 – ₹5,000.

4. Miscellaneous Fees

  • Library Fee: The annual library fee of ₹2,000 provides students access to an extensive collection of physical and digital resources. This includes architecture books, journals, research papers, & design manuals that support academic and professional development.

  • Workshop Fee: The ₹5,000 yearly workshop fee covers the costs of materials, tools, and other resources required for hands-on activities. These sessions often include model-making material experiments, & technical design projects, essential for practical learning in architecture.

  • Laboratory Fee: For ₹4,000 per year, students gain access to high-end laboratory equipment used for architectural analysis, structural testing, and design innovation. These facilities support advanced research & experimentation enhancing the learning experience.

5. Hostel and Accommodation Fees

On-Campus Hostel Features:

  • Fully furnished rooms with shared or individual occupancy options.

  • Recreational facilities and 24/7 security.

Approximate Cost: ₹60,000 – ₹80,000/year.

Off-Campus Options:

  • Private rentals near the campus with varied costs depending on facilities and proximity.

6. Field Trips and Study Tours

Enriching site visits, architectural excursions, and real-world exposure to urban planning projects.

Cost Breakdown:

  • Transportation and accommodation.

  • Entry fees and guides at historical or contemporary architectural sites.

Approximate Cost Per Trip: ₹10,000 – ₹20,000.

7. Scholarships and Financial Aid

Merit-Based Scholarships:

  • For students with outstanding academic and design performance.

  • Can reduce tuition fees by a significant percentage.

Need-Based Assistance:

  • Support for economically disadvantaged students through state and central government programs.

Guidance for Education Loans:

  • Assistance in securing loans from reputed banks.

8. RR School of Architecture Costs

Alumni Association Fee:

  • A one-time fee of ₹2,000 – ₹3,000 for lifelong membership, offering networking opportunities and alumni events.

Project Materials Cost:

  • Students need to purchase supplies for assignments and model-making.

  • Estimated Annual Cost: ₹5,000 – ₹15,000.

RR School of Architecture Syllabus

The Bachelor of Architecture (B.Arch) program at RR School of Architecture follows a comprehensive and interdisciplinary syllabus designed to prepare students for careers in architecture, urban planning, & sustainable design. 

The syllabus aligns with the guidelines of the Council of Architecture (COA) and incorporates a blend of theoretical knowledge, practical skills, & project-based learning.

Year 1: Foundation Year

Focus: Fundamentals of design, drawing skills, and architectural history.

Semester 1:

  • Architectural Design Fundamentals

  • Building Materials and Construction Techniques – I

  • Architectural Graphics and Drawing – I

  • Structural Mechanics – I

  • History of Architecture – Ancient Civilizations

  • Environmental Studies

Semester 2:

  • Design Studio – Basic Principles

  • Building Materials and Construction Techniques – II

  • Architectural Graphics and Drawing – II

  • Structural Mechanics – II

  • History of Architecture – Medieval and Vernacular Styles

  • Communication Skills

Year 2: Intermediate Concepts

Focus: Exploring design in residential, cultural, and commercial spaces.

Semester 3:

  • Residential Design Studio

  • Building Materials and Construction Techniques – III

  • Structural Systems – Steel and Timber

  • History of Architecture – Renaissance to Modern

  • Site Planning and Landscape Design

  • Computer-Aided Design (CAD) – Basics

Semester 4:

  • Cultural and Commercial Design Studio

  • Advanced Building Construction Techniques

  • Structural Systems – Concrete and Composite Materials

  • Theory of Architecture

  • Climate Responsive Architecture

  • Advanced CAD Applications

Year 3: Advanced Design and Planning

Focus: Urban design, sustainable practices, and advanced construction.

Semester 5:

  • Urban Design Studio

  • Advanced Structural Design

  • Sustainable Architecture Practices

  • History of Contemporary Architecture

  • Building Services – HVAC and Plumbing

  • Research Methods in Architecture

Semester 6:

  • Institutional and Public Building Design Studio

  • Urban and Regional Planning

  • Building Services – Electrical and Fire Safety

  • Project Management and Estimation

  • Elective – Green Building Design / Parametric Design

Year 4: Specialized Learning

Focus: Advanced architectural research and real-world applications.

Semester 7:

  • Architectural Thesis Preparation

  • Construction Technology – Advanced Systems

  • Smart Cities and Urban Development

  • Professional Practice – Legal Aspects and Ethics

  • Elective – Landscape Architecture / Interior Design

Semester 8:

  • Architectural Internship (6 Months)

  • On-site learning with reputed architecture firms.

  • Industry-based assignments & project reviews.

Year 5: Thesis and Specialization

Focus: Independent project work and preparing for professional practice.

Semester 9:

  • Thesis Project – Concept Development

  • Sustainable Urban Planning Strategies

  • Elective – Heritage Conservation / Digital Architecture

  • Entrepreneurial Skills for Architects

Semester 10:

  • Final Thesis Submission and Jury Presentation

  • Portfolio Development and Professional Networking

  • Industry Seminars and Guest Lectures

Electives Offered

  • Green Architecture

  • Digital Fabrication

  • Urban Revitalization

  • Heritage Conservation

  • Interior Architecture
